Read Revelation 11:15-19.
The seventh trumpet is blown, signaling that God’s Kingdom is here to stay and Jesus will reign forever! This is a promise we can hold onto throughout life’s challenges. When we experience chaos, loneliness, and trials, this passage is proof that God is, was, and always will be in control. Heaven celebrates this victory, with loud voices proclaiming that the kingdom of the world has now become God’s kingdom!

Memorize it
“We give thanks to you, Lord God Almighty,
the One who is and who was,
because you have taken your great power
and have begun to reign."
- Revelation 11:17
